The pressure coming from being in a famous family is likely not easy to handle, but Noah Cyrus, the little sister of Miley, is forging her own path via a music career. On her debut track, "Make Me (Cry)", she and London singer Labrinth trade lines and sing sweetly and soulfully in unison as well. The sharp, floating production beneath them is nothing short of stellar, too, and the song of theirs turns out to be a truly dynamic offering that changes every thirty seconds or so. In a recipe that could call for far too much, Cyrus avoided getting drowned out, and, as a new artist, that's a truly remarkable feat.
